Story summary
- Mayor Jonathan Varden of Jemison, Alabama, confirmed a joint operation by U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) and local law enforcement that included driver’s license checkpoints.
- Operation heightened tensions and sparked protests on November 18.
- Organizer Irbin Hernandez noted increased division and threats against protesters.
- Co-organizer Stacy Serrano said residents fear contacting police due to perceived ICE collaboration.
- Mayor Jonathan Varden condemned online threats and said an investigation is ongoing.
